DHL SE, DK and FI are changing to a new pricing API by mid-January 2024. Ship customers using standard price calculation must update their credentials (DHL e-ID) to continue to receive prices from DHL.
This guide will explain how to update the credentials according to your Ship solution:

Important! DHL SE customers must apply for an e-ID here: DHL FI and DK customers will receive the new credentials from DHL. nShift customer service does not have access to your DHL e-ID/new credentials. |
Update credentials in On-premises
Once you have obtained your new credentials, follow these steps to add them to nShift On-premises:
- Go to Setup and find DHL Sverige, DHL Danmark and/or DHL Finland. The image below shows all affected subcarriers but you only need to update the ones available in your installation.
- Click on a subcarrier and locate the Price Calculation setup item.
- Double-click the Price Calculation icon and click Configure.
- Fill in Username and Password (obtained from DHL) and click OK.
- Click OK again to save and close the Price Calculation setup.
- Repeat steps 2-5 for any remaining subcarriers.
Update credentials in Hosted solutions (Shipment Server and Ticket)
Once you have obtained your new credentials, follow these steps to add them to your hosted Ship solution:
- Log into nShift Portal with your Owner or Admin user.
- Go to Ship > Configuration > Actors and Carriers.
- Click on the Actor and find DHL Sverige, DHL Danmark and/or DHL Finland.
- Click on the carrier and then the product group. The affected product groups that need new credentials are:

- DHL Sverige > DHL Freight Domestic, DHL Home Delivery, Service Point, and Service Point Retur.
- DHL Danmark > DHL Freight
- DHL Finland > DHL Freight

- Locate and expand the Price Calculation section. Please note that it may be activated under the individual products. You must locate and update ALL the Price Calculation sections under the relevant DHL carriers.
- Make sure the box next to Calculation active is checked and Standard (calculated by carrier if available) is selected. Fill in Username and Password with the credentials you received from DHL (Note: Swedish customers must apply for a DHL e-ID themselves).
- Click Save and repeat for any additional Price Calculation sections.
Update the carrier account number
If you have received a new customer number from DHL, you need to add it to your setup. Follow the steps below if you have an On-premises solution. If you have a hosted solution (Shipment Server or Ticket) you need to contact nShift Customer Service who can help you update the carrier account number.
- Go to Setup and find the relevant DHL carrier.
- Locate and double-click the Carrier Account icon. It is usually placed at the subcarrier level but may also be at the product level.
- Update the Account number and click OK.
